What is the need of batch apex in Salesforce? WebJan 26, 2011 · FM systems use a pre-emphasis for the audio signals. That means, all audio frequencies above a corner frequency are emphasized. The corner frequencies are: f c = 2.1221 kHz for region 2 (the Americas) f c = 3.1831 kHz for Region 1 (Europe and Asia) This gives the time constants: τ = 75 μsec for region 2. τ = 50 μsec for region 1.

WebJul 23, 2024 · So there's no confusion, pre-emphasis is a high-pass filtering action, and de-emphasis is a low-pass filtering action. 6dB/octave is a relatively mild response - it's what you get with a single resistor-capacitor filter. While it IS a filter and called a filter, it doesn't filter *out* much. It changes the frequency response a little bit. WebWhat is pre-emphasis and de-emphasis Tutorialspoint? WebThe De-emphasis does exactly reverse of the Pre-emphasis counterpart. It is used at the receiver part. It helps bring pre-amplified signal back to the normal amplitude level. It is a simple Low Pass Filter with time constant of about 75 µs . De-emphasis circuit will have cutoff frequency of about 2123 Hz. WebNov 17, 2024 · 1.3 Pre-emphasis. Pre-emphasis is a way to boost only the signal's high-frequency components, while leaving the low-frequency components in their original state. Pre-emphasis operates by boosting the high-frequency energy every time a transition in the data occurs. The data edges contain the signal's high-frequency content.

RIAA equalization is a form of pre-emphasis on recording and de-emphasis on playback. A recording is made with the low frequencies reduced and the high frequencies boosted, and on playback, the opposite occurs.
